These blokes should ask themselves what we'd do with another average fullback. Edwards seems to have re-established himself to some degree and a signing like this would only destabilise the playing group.
100%. Hes a downgrade on what we have

Edwards is reasonably quick... maybe a fraction slower than Thompson. But he has him covered for size, workload and ball playing... not that Edwards is very good at it.

Edwards has 8 try assists in 35 games.
Thompson has 2 try assists in 68 games.

Edwards also averages 20 metres more per game in what is undoubtedly his worst form since hitting first grade. Has a better tackle percentage and averages more tackle busts per game than Thompson... although Thompson had 14 tackle breaks in a single game against an Origin depleted Souths. Otherwise he's average in that area too.

Basically Thompson is only decent if he gets the ball with no one in front of him. In which case Naden, To'o and Blake would be equally as effective if not moreso. Only real player he would offer a significant speed bump over is Mansour. But for mine Naden should be his replacement.

Thankfully this Thompson business looks unlikely to happen though.

Quick run down of RCG’s stats

He runs for 8.6m per run, this is 42nd in the comp *amongst props*

He has 8 tackle busts, 41st amongst props

He has 134 total runs, 30th amongst props

396 tackles, 6th amongst props

6 errors, 12th among props

6 offloads, 33rd among props




The only good stat is the amount of tackles, but that could just be because we mostly do a 3 man prop rotation.

For instance RCG has the 15th most minutes of any prop, given this his stats should be much better.
